Transaction 71c24741a515c04a5f992d60516ab3cb78497c4f0d17c1739b8852197755353c

3 Input
2 Outputs
  • 71c24741a515c04a5f992d60516ab3cb78497c4f0d17c1739b8852197755353c:0
  • value  1344004
    address  3MpRm5yP4UVCFVRDwV8wHyUVVRL1JZMf9J
  • 71c24741a515c04a5f992d60516ab3cb78497c4f0d17c1739b8852197755353c:1
  • value  33003
    address  17XAzCoh89yF49i8u3NmQdX4TKnCfDHZ4f